"Ninja Gaiden 2 Black Update: New Game Plus and More Added"

by Alexis Mar 28,2025

Team Ninja has rolled out a significant update for Ninja Gaiden 2 Black, elevating it to version 1.0.7.0. This update, which fulfills earlier promises to address fan feedback, introduces several exciting features and improvements. The patch is now available across P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X and S, and PC platforms via Steam and the Microsoft Store.

One of the headline additions is New Game Plus, allowing players to embark on a fresh run on any difficulty they've previously completed, retaining their arsenal of weapons and Ninpo. However, these items will reset to Level 1, and players cannot directly access a higher difficulty through New Game Plus.

Another quality-of-life enhancement is the option to hide the projectile weapon carried on the player's back. This can be toggled in the Game Settings under the Options menu, offering a cleaner visual experience for those who prefer it.

In terms of balance adjustments, Team Ninja has made significant changes to enemy encounters. The Hit Points of enemies in Chapter 8 ("City of the Fallen Goddess") and Chapter 11 ("Night in the City of Water") have been reduced. Conversely, the number of enemies in Chapter 13 ("The Temple of Sacrifice") and Chapter 14 ("A Tempered Gravestone") has been increased. Additionally, the damage output of some of Ayane's attacks has been boosted.

The update also addresses several bugs, including control issues at high frame rates and under heavy computing loads, controller vibration inconsistencies, out-of-bounds glitches in specific chapters, progression-blocking bugs, and crashes during extended play sessions. A comprehensive list of patch notes is provided below.

Ninja Gaiden 2 Black, which was unexpectedly unveiled at the January Xbox Developer Direct, is an enhanced edition of the iconic action game, rebuilt with Unreal Engine 5. This upgrade not only improves graphic fidelity but also introduces new playable characters and enhances battle support functions. In IGN's review, Ninja Gaiden 2 Black received an 8/10, praised as a stunning improvement over its Sigma 2 counterpart and hailed as an exceptional action game despite some minor criticisms regarding enemy health and numbers.

Ninja Gaiden 2 Black Ver 1.0.7.0 Patch Notes

Additional Content:

  • New Game+: Players can now start a new game on any previously cleared difficulty with weapons and Ninpo obtained from the previous playthrough, though they will revert to Level 1.
  • Photo Mode: Added to the in-game Options Menu, allowing players to adjust the camera within set limits for taking screenshots.
  • Ability to Hide Projectile Weapon: A "Show Projectile Weapon" option has been added to the Game Settings in the Options Menu, enabling players to hide their projectile weapon when carried on their back.

Adjustments:

  • Lowered the HP of enemies in Chapter 8, "City of the Fallen Goddess."
  • Lowered the HP of enemies in Chapter 11, "Night in the City of Water."
  • Raised the number of enemies in Chapter 13, "The Temple of Sacrifice."
  • Raised the number of enemies in Chapter 14, "A Tempered Gravestone."
  • Increased the damage dealt by some of Ayane's attacks.

Bug Fixes:

  • Fixed control issues that occurred when playing at over 120 FPS or under high computing load.
  • Addressed an issue where controllers would not vibrate based on computing load or FPS settings.
  • Resolved bugs causing players to go out of bounds during certain chapters.
  • Fixed bugs that made progression impossible during specific chapters.
  • Corrected a bug causing the game to crash during long play sessions.
  • Implemented other minor bug fixes.
